    I have an issue regarding electrical outlets. Used an outlet tester, and so far, 2 rooms seem to have problems.

    Room 1 has 1 outlet working normally, and 2 outlet testing open ground
    Room 2 has all outlet testing open ground.

    The problem is when I popped the open ground ones all open... the ground line is wired correctly to the green bolt. Went out and bought new 3-prong outlets and replaced 2/6 of them and they are still testing open ground, and didn't waste further time replacing other 4.

    The ground line could’ve been interrupted in the circuit somewhere.

    A trick I’ve done when doing electrical work (I work with a general contractor, so I’m your jack-of-all-trades type) is to pigtail the same gauge wire from the ground screw into the neutral screw on the outlet. If you happen to do this to the right outlet in the circuit, it may correct all the other open grounds.

    Clearing the line isn't that bad, the fun comes from why it clogged to begin with. Roots or old busted clay lines can lead to massive repair bills real quick. Here's hoping if there is such an issue, it's on the city's end.
